Entrance Preview

JEE, i was ranked 2541 in jee and chosen this college since my family could not afford other private college which has exorbitant fee structures. Overall this college had good name that time of producing good students, so i chosen this college. also the added advantage was that i got the hostel facility which was beneficial to me.

Course Curriculum Overview

3.5

Good, the course curricula was good and was given by wbut since the college was under the aegis of west bengal university of technology. Faculty-wise it was good although the number of faculty was a bit less than adequate that time( during 2001-2005). However the faculties present that time was good in terms of technical expertise and teaching techniques. The course curriculum was in line with what needed to be to be a good it engineer. If some students give their best attention to studies as per the curriculum he/she is bound to achieve good results.

College Events

3.5

Reunion event, biswakarma and saraswati festivals etc. The reunion was the most exciting event spanning 3-4 days where college alumni gathers and shares their current work experiences making it very useful for the current students. Also its generally followed by lunch and renowned bands performing making it very enjoyable to the students.

Fee Structure And Facilities

Fee structure was almost 12000/- per annually as tuition fees considering a government college it was comparatively lesser than most other private college. College hostel facility was good and fulfilling for the self development of a student. It was definitely feasible in the year 2001-2005 that i studied in the college. There was separate hostel change which was also affordable. And most probably there was no other charges at that time.

Fees and Financial Aid

For scheduled cast candidates government was preparing separate scholarship facility. For general candidates there was no scholarship as far as my knowledge.

Campus Life

3.5

Campus life was exciting and full of good experiences. Labs were of fairly good quality for different computer subjects, there were annual sports events conducted which i loved to attend and win prizes. There were also some competitions conducted such as annual cultural events, debates etc which we enjoyed to participate. Also there was scope for students who wanted to do some extra in lab.
